Post by 90GTVert on Jul 12, 2011 19:12:03 GMT -5
I ran my 12V outlet off of ign switched power. Makes it easier not to forget to turn it off and it saves on a switch. The only down side is that when I turn my scoot off to get gas or whatever, my GPS wants to power down if I don't tell it not to.

Post by 90GTVert on Jul 12, 2011 22:09:31 GMT -5
Red/White is pretty common. Check right at or around the ign switch if you don't see red/white. Get the multimeter or volt meter out to be sure before you do any splicing.
